    ------------*****Help with math M1*****------------

    Total distance moved if deceleration were uniform = Area under trapezium from t=o to t=24 = 0.5*(20+24)*7 = 154m But since deceleration was not uniform, the actual area under graph is greater than the area under the trapezium. Therefore, the total distance run by the man is greater than 154m...
